Patterns of recurrence after liver resection with wide- and narrow-margin.

Parameters The entire cohort (n, %)
Wide margin Narrow margin
No TACE
(n =186)
TACE
(n = 211)
P No TACE
(n = 112)
TACE
(n = 161)
P
No. of recurrent cases 81(43.5) 92(43.6) 1.000 74(66.1) 90(55.9) .118
Time to recurrence, months
 ≤24 74(39.7) 69(32.7) .173 64(57.1) 74(46.0) .090
Type of recurrence
 Intrahepatic 58(31.2) 62(29.3) .779 59(52.6) 63(39.1) .036
 Extrahepatic 15(8.0) 18(8.6) 1.000 9(8.0) 17(10.6) .648
 Intra-plus extrahepatic 8(4.3) 11(5.2) .849 6(5.3) 10(6.2) .973
Site of intrahepatic recurrence
 Local 26(14.0) 27(12.8) .843 24(21.4) 18(11.2) .032
 Adjacent segment 19(10.2) 21(10.0) 1.000 17(15.2) 20(12.4) .635
 Distal segment 12(6.4) 15(7.1) .953 13(11.6) 17(10.5) .939
 Multisegment 9 (4.8) 10(4.7) 1.000 11(9.8) 18(11.1) .873
Recurrence .280 .024
 1-year recurrence rate, % 29.6 25.4 38.4 31.9
 3-year recurrence rate, % 49.6 44.4 71.1 56.9
 5-year recurrence rate, % 54.4 49.8 76.4 62.9

Calculated in patients with intrahepatic only and intra-plus extrahepatic recurrences. Bold values indicate statistical significance (P < .05).

Local recurrence, any recurrence located within 2 cm of the surgical margin, irrespective of any additional recurrence in other parts of the liver; adjacent segment recurrence, any recurrence located in the adjacent segment or in the same segment after subsegmentectomy, but with 2 cm away from the surgical margin; distal segment recurrence, any recurrence located not in the adjacent segment or in the contralateral hemiliver; multisegment recurrences, recurrences which involve multiple hepatic segments.
